Understanding VPCs: The Bedrock of Cloud Networking

Virtual Private Clouds (VPCs) are the backbone of cloud networking. They provide a secure, isolated environment within a public cloud, allowing organizations to leverage the scalability and flexibility of the cloud while maintaining control over their resources. Hybrid Architectures: Bridging the Gap Between On-Premises and Cloud

Hybrid architectures combine on-premises infrastructure with cloud services, offering the best of both worlds. This approach allows organizations to migrate critical workloads to the cloud gradually, ensuring business continuity and minimizing disruption.

Practical Insight:

Imagine a manufacturing company with legacy systems that cannot be easily migrated to the cloud. Hybrid architectures enable them to keep these systems on-premises while leveraging cloud services for new applications. This hybrid approach provides the flexibility to innovate without compromising on existing infrastructure.
